Researchers propose the Large Cancer Assistant (LCA), a model-agnostic orchestration framework for multimodal AI in oncology that decouples data ingestion, clinical routing, and AI inference via a 7-tuple architecture grounded in 'Algorithmic Impermeability.' The system uses Geometric Deep Learning to standardize multimodal patient data and outputs a Standardized Intermediate Payload (SIP) to isolate AI execution from hospital IT infrastructure. A proof-of-concept validated orchestration logic across four scenarios, demonstrating invariant routing during model swaps and 100% recall on failure-safety under injected data anomalies. The framework targets EMR interoperability and modular deployment of heterogeneous oncology AI models.
